sql >> Database >  >> RDS >> Mysql

MySQL Selecteer rijen met een tijdstempel tussen nu en 10 minuten geleden

Gebruik:

  SELECT *
    FROM status
   WHERE code = 'myCode'
     AND `stamp_updated` BETWEEN DATE_SUB(NOW() , INTERVAL 10 MINUTE)
                           AND NOW()
ORDER BY stamp_updated DESC
   LIMIT 1

Orde in de TUSSEN-operator is belangrijk - je had het achterstevoren.



  1. Hoe maak je een tabel met een externe sleutelbeperking in SQL Server - SQL Server / TSQL-zelfstudie, deel 66

  2. PostgreSQL IN-operator met slechte prestaties van subquery

  3. Is het in SQL OK dat twee tabellen naar elkaar verwijzen?

  4. Python, Brew en MySQLdb